Sign in nowThe National Infrastructure Pipeline (NIP) is a group of social and economic infrastructure projects in India over a period of five years with an initial sanctioned amount of ₹102 lakh crore. The centre (39 percent) and state (39 percent) are expected to have an almost equal share in implementing the projects, while the private sector has 22 percent share. The India Investment Grid is designed to give real-time updates on the implementation of the National Infrastructure Pipeline (NIP).
